Resistance Fighters
The Global Antibiotics-Crisis

Every year, 700,000 people die from infections caused by multi-resistant germs. According to studies, this number may rise to ten million annually by 2050. We are facing the "post-antibiotic era" - a time when drugs can no longer protect us against infections.

The film tells the story of how negligence, greed and short-sightedness have all but undermined the effectiveness of life-saving antibiotics. A science thriller about desperately struggling doctors, rebelling scientists, death-wrestling patients and diplomats looking for a global solution. They are all the Resistance Fighters.
